Ahmad Jamal biography

Ahmad Jamal (born July 2, 1930) is a well-known American Jazz pianist from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, USA. His given name was Fritz Jones but upon converting to Islam around 1952 he began using Ahmad Jamal. Jamal was one of Miles Davis's favorite pianists and was a key influence on the trumpeter's 1st Great Quintet.
